02 Purpose and work
What the charity exists to do
The promotion of the Christian Faith and its values amongst its members and the community at large, the prevention or relief of poverty through outreach work, and the provision of food and other necessities to people in need in the local community.

Constitutional objectives
4. The organisation’s purposes are: 4.1 To advance the Christian faith in Paisley, Renfrewshire, with particular focus on Shortroods and surrounding neighbourhoods, through worship, discipleship, and outreach, promoting spiritual wellbeing, moral development, and compassionate living in accordance with the teachings of Jesus Christ. 4.2 To relieve poverty and financial hardship within Paisley and Renfrewshire by providing practical support, food assistance, skills development, and community based programmes for individuals and families experiencing disadvantage, regardless of background, belief, or circumstance. 4.3 To advance citizenship and community development in Paisley and Renfrewshire by delivering inclusive programmes that promote social cohesion, youth empowerment, personal transformation, and long term regeneration of individuals and communities. 4.4 To promote education and lifelong learning in Paisley and Renfrewshire, including faith based and secular training, leadership development, and mentoring opportunities that equip people to lead purposeful, resilient lives. 4.5 To provide facilities and services for community benefit in Paisley and Renfrewshire, including spaces for wellbeing, recreation, and support services, with a commitment to inclusive access and collaborative use of assets for the common good. 4.6 Use of facilities and participation in programmes will be open to all members of the community in Paisley and Renfrewshire, regardless of faith, belief, or background, with particular regard to serving the needs of residents in Shortroods and central Paisley neighbourhoods.
